If two angles are complementary and one of them is 77°, what is the size of the other angle?

Answer:

13°

Step-by-step explanation:

Complementary angles add to 90 degrees, therefore,

∠1+∠2=90

We know one of the angles is 77 degrees, so we can substitute that in.

77+ ∠2=90

Subtract 77 from both sides to solve for the angle

∠2=13

So, the angle is 13 degrees
